Is It Legal to Use a VPN in Taipei?


Yes, using a VPN in Taipei—and throughout Taiwan—is completely legal. Locals, expats, and businesses rely on VPNs daily to secure public Wi-Fi, protect remote work, and access Taiwan-based services from abroad. Just remember: a VPN safeguards your privacy, but it doesn’t make illegal activity legal.
